Jeffs Wrap up Perfect Weekend with 3-1 Win at Bates

LEWISTON, ME – The Amherst College volleyball team wrapped up a perfect weekend with a 3-1 win over Bates College Saturday afternoon to improve its record to 5-1 (2-0 NESCAC) on the season. Bates falls to 4-2 overall and 0-2 in conference play. 

Bates team hung tough with conference rival Amherst, but the Jeffs picked up the 3-1 (22-25, 31-29, 25-19, 25-13) win. The Bobcats won the first set and battled to 30-29 in the second set before Lord Jeffs claimed it. 

Junior Katherine Jordan (Los Altos Hills, CA) had 48 assists for Amherst. First-year Emily Waterhouse (Sherman Oaks, CA) added 12 kills and four blocks for the Lord Jeffs, while sophomore Katherine Kanoff (Pacific Palisades, CA) had a team-high 14 kills with two service aces. Junior middle hitter Laura Hyman (Glencoe, IL) added 11 kills, while junior tri-captain Rachel Yorke (Los Angeles, CA) paced the back row with 11 digs.

Sophomore Grace Haessler paced the Bates offense with 55 assists, while senior Liz Leberman had a team-high 17 kills to go with seven digs for the Bobcats. Senior Avery Masters had 13 kills while sophomore Olivia Schow contributed 11 kills, three aces and four blocks. First-year Nicole Russell led the back row defense with 19 digs.

The Lord Jeffs return to action Tuesday, Sept. 22 when they host Johnson & Wales University in their 2009 home opener. Tuesday's match will feature a live webcast courtesy of JeffCast.
